Transaction 2ddfa5e8afb9a585b168512113c8a26f0f411cb16074f1c3a85441377466b19d
1 Input
2 Outputs
- 2ddfa5e8afb9a585b168512113c8a26f0f411cb16074f1c3a85441377466b19d:0
- 2ddfa5e8afb9a585b168512113c8a26f0f411cb16074f1c3a85441377466b19d:1
value 12491208
address 13uuen7LCH4FCpmg1gak1LQJR4QzRf2EDx
value 37699408
address 1KQ93PZYzLnTGzPkzrrDKDDkq7ASJhcm2J